Page OverviewUnderstanding 511
Known as America's Traveler Information Telephone Number, 511 is the easy-to-remember (and easy-to-dial!) telephone number that travelers throughout much of America use to access traffic-related information.
511 helps travelers―even if they're just commuting to work―find the quickest and safest route possible. This cuts travel time, fuel costs, and vehicle emissions. A well-planned driving route can even help reduce the risk of an accident.
511 Massachusetts
Fortunately, Massachusetts is one of the many states that has implemented 511. You can find information about various coverage areas from 5:30 a.m. until 9 p.m. Monday-Friday, and from 10 a.m. until 7 p.m. on weekends and holidays.
How you access traffic-related information depends on the type of phone you use:
- From cell phones: Call 511.
- From land lines (including pay phones): Call (617) 374-1234.
All applicable charges apply. In other words, your applicable cell phone minutes will be used, you'll be charged if the 617 area code is long distance for you, and you'll need to pay to use a pay phone.
